Where each one shines

What Danelfin and Dividend Watch each do best.
Show
Danelfin logo

What Danelfin does best

  1. Rank U.S.-listed stocks, ETFs, and major European stocks with Danelfin AI Scores designed to estimate three-month market-outperformance probability.
  2. Screening for ideas by asset type, ticker, sector, industry, AI Score, buy or sell signals, trade ideas, and other plan-gated ranking filters.
  3. Views for reviewing stock and ETF pages with AI Score context, historical score behavior, rankings, ratings, and supporting technical, fundamental, and sentiment inputs.
  4. Curated top lists, thematic lists, sector views, industry views, and the daily Top 10 stocks newsletter for structured idea discovery.
  5. Monitoring portfolios with score-upgrade and score-downgrade alerts, with portfolio count and holding limits increasing by plan.
Dividend Watch logo

What Dividend Watch does best

  1. Tracking past, current, and projected dividend income by holding and portfolio so income investors can see what their portfolio is paying them.
  2. Mark dividends as reinvested with DRIP tracking and see the effect on income, yield on cost, and portfolio value.
  3. A portfolio calendar for earnings reports, dividend declarations, ex-dividend dates, pay dates, and portfolio news.
  4. Views for reviewing 12-month forward dividend income projections with status labels such as estimated, confirmed, and paid.
  5. Management tools for multiple portfolios and watchlists on paid tiers, with diversification dashboards across sector, geography, dividend growth, yield on cost, total return, and currency effects.

Questions we keep getting

What's the difference between Danelfin and Dividend Watch?

Danelfin leans toward stock ideas, screeners, and portfolio, while Dividend Watch puts more weight on portfolio, watchlist, and dividends. They overlap in 5 categories, so for most people it comes down to workflow preference and price.

How much do Danelfin and Dividend Watch cost?

Good news: both Danelfin and Dividend Watch have free plans, so you can run them side by side and only pay if you hit a wall.

Does Danelfin or Dividend Watch have an API?

Danelfin has an API for programmatic access and custom integrations. Dividend Watch doesn't, so you're working through its interface.

Should I choose Danelfin or Dividend Watch?

It depends on what you're after. Pick Danelfin if alerts and ETF analysis matter to you; go with Dividend Watch if you'd rather have dividends and calendar. And if you only need the basics both share, let price decide.

Can I export data from Danelfin and Dividend Watch?

Yes, both export to spreadsheets (CSV), which is handy if you like running your own numbers.

Can Danelfin or Dividend Watch connect to my broker?

Dividend Watch syncs with brokers automatically. With Danelfin, you're entering holdings by hand or importing files.

Which has a better stock screener: Danelfin or Dividend Watch?

Both Danelfin and Dividend Watch include stock screeners, and they differ more in interface than raw power; try both and see which one clicks for you.

Can I track my portfolio with Danelfin or Dividend Watch?

Yes, both do portfolio tracking: holdings, performance, and allocation in one place.
